A Tulsa mother charged with child neglect will stand trial.
Erin Lewallen faces one count of child neglect. Police were called the a north Tulsa home in November after a neighbor saw a naked three-year old boy in Lewallen’s backyard.
Police say Lewallen was not home at the time, but her husband William was, police found a 22-month girl locked inside a dog crate in the house. Another three-year old boy was discovered naked and asleep next to William Lewallen. Police say William Lewallen had taken narcotic painkillers with beer to deal with back pain.
He was also bound over for trial on a child neglect charge.
